Advertisement
Peaceseeker

updated qt4-fsarchiver PKGBUILD

Jun 4th, 2013
100
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.16 KB | None | 0 0
  1. # qt4-fsarchiver by Francois Dupoux, Hihin Ruslan and Dieter Baum
  2. # PKGBUILD by hasufell, updated by DaarkWel
  3.  
  4. pkgname=qt4-fsarchiver
  5. pkgver=0.6.17_3
  6. pkgrel=1
  7. pkgdesc='GUI for fsarchiver'
  8. arch=('i686' 'x86_64')
  9. url='http://sourceforge.net/projects/qt4-fsarchiver/'
  10. license=('GPL')
  11. depends=('fsarchiver' 'gksu')
  12. makedepends=('qt4')
  13. source=("http://sourceforge.net/projects/${pkgname}/files/source/${pkgname}-${pkgver//_/-}.tar.gz")
  14.  
  15. sha1sums=('8b474af6fd81d604f357348567608f450dbe83e7')
  16.  
  17. prepare() {
  18. # patch installer to use 'usr/bin'
  19. cd "${srcdir}/${pkgname}"
  20. sed -i -e "s|target.path = /usr/sbin|target.path = /usr/bin|" \
  21. $(find . -name 'qt4-fsarchiver.pro')
  22. }
  23.  
  24. build() {
  25. cd "${srcdir}/${pkgname}"
  26. qmake-qt4
  27. make
  28. }
  29.  
  30. package() {
  31. cd "${srcdir}/${pkgname}"
  32. make INSTALL_ROOT="${pkgdir}" install
  33. mkdir -p ${pkgdir}/usr/share/qt/translations
  34. rm -R ${pkgdir}/usr/share/qt4
  35. install -D -m644 ${srcdir}/${pkgname}/translations/*.qm ${pkgdir}/usr/share/qt/translations
  36. sed s/Terminal=true/Terminal=false/ -i ${pkgdir}/usr/share/applications/qt4-fsarchiver.desktop
  37. sed s/sudo/gksu/ -i ${pkgdir}/usr/share/applications/qt4-fsarchiver.desktop
  38.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ement